Commit 9ca6711faa changed the Wayland winsys to only block for the
frame callback inside SwapBuffers, rather than get_back_bo. get_back_bo
would perform a single non-blocking Wayland event dispatch, to try to
find any release events which we had pulled off the wire but not
actually processed. The blocking dispatch was moved to SwapBuffers.
This removed a guarantee that we would've processed all events inside
get_back_bo(), and introduced a failure whereby the server could've sent
a buffer release event, but we wouldn't have read it. In clients
unconstrained by SwapInterval (rendering ~as fast as possible), which
were being displayed directly without composition (buffer release delayed),
this could lead to get_back_bo() failing because there were no free
buffers available to it.
The drawing rightly failed, but this was papered over because of the
path in eglSwapBuffers() which attempts to guarantee a BO, in order to
support calling SwapBuffers twice in a row with no rendering actually
having been performed.
Since eglSwapBuffers will perform a blocking dispatch of Wayland
events, a buffer release would have arrived by that point, and we
could then choose a buffer to post to the server. The effect was that
frames were displayed out-of-order, since we grabbed a frame with random
past content to display to the compositor.
Ideally get_back_bo() failing should store a failure flag inside the
surface and cause the next SwapBuffers to fail, but for the meantime,
restore the correct behaviour such that get_back_bo() no longer fails.

The procedure for decompressing an opaque DXT1 OpenGL format is
dependant on the comparison of two colors stored in the first 32 bits of
the compressed block. Here's the specified OpenGL behavior for
reference:
The RGB color for a texel at location (x,y) in the block is given by:
RGB0, if color0 > color1 and code(x,y) == 0
RGB1, if color0 > color1 and code(x,y) == 1
(2*RGB0+RGB1)/3, if color0 > color1 and code(x,y) == 2
(RGB0+2*RGB1)/3, if color0 > color1 and code(x,y) == 3
RGB0, if color0 <= color1 and code(x,y) == 0
RGB1, if color0 <= color1 and code(x,y) == 1
(RGB0+RGB1)/2, if color0 <= color1 and code(x,y) == 2
BLACK, if color0 <= color1 and code(x,y) == 3
The sampling operation performed on an opaque DXT1 Intel format essentially
hard-codes the comparison result of the two colors as color0 > color1.
This means that the behavior is incompatible with OpenGL. This is stated
in the SKL PRM, Vol 5: Memory Views:
Opaque Textures (DXT1_RGB)
Texture format DXT1_RGB is identical to DXT1, with the exception that the
One-bit Alpha encoding is removed. Color 0 and Color 1 are not compared, and
the resulting texel color is derived strictly from the Opaque Color Encoding.
The alpha channel defaults to 1.0.
Programming Note
Context: Opaque Textures (DXT1_RGB)
The behavior of this format is not compliant with the OGL spec.
The opaque and non-opaque DXT1 OpenGL formats are specified to be
decoded in exactly the same way except the BLACK value must have a
transparent alpha channel in the latter. Use the four-channel BC1 Intel
formats with the alpha set to 1 to provide the behavior required by the
spec. Note that the alpha is already set to 1 for RGB formats in
brw_get_texture_swizzle().

The datalayout for modules was purposely not being set in order to work around
the fact that the ExecutionEngine requires that the module's datalayout
matches the datalayout of the TargetMachine that the ExecutionEngine is
using.
When the pass manager runs on a module with no datalayout, it uses
the default datalayout which is little-endian. This causes problems
on big-endian targets, because some optimizations that are legal on
little-endian or illegal on big-endian.
To resolve this, we set the datalayout prior to running the pass
manager, and then clear it before creating the ExectionEngine.
This patch fixes a lot of piglit tests on big-endian ppc64.

We check these bitfields when computing the Haswell max GL version.
We need to set them ahead of time, or they won't exist, and all our
checks will fail. That sets the max core profile GL version to 4.2.
This introduces the bizarre situation where asking for a GL context
with version 4.3+ fails, but asking for a GL core profile context
with version <= 4.2 actually promotes you a 4.5 context.
GLX_MESA_query_renderer also reported the bogus 4.2 value.
Now it shows 4.5.

In commit d2590eb65f I enabled GL 4.5
on Haswell...but failed to check if we could do indirect compute
shader dispatch...and query buffer objects.
Indirect compute shader dispatch requires command parser version 5
(kernel commit 7b9748cb513a6bef4af87b79f0da3ff7e8b56cd8, which is in
Linux v4.4). On earlier kernels we would have disabled
ARB_compute_shader, which is a mandatory part of OpenGL 4.3+.
Query buffer objects currently require MI_MATH and MI_LOAD_REGISTER_REG,
which mean command parser version 7 (Linux v4.8). On earlier kernels
we would have disabled ARB_query_buffer_object, which is a mandatory
part of OpenGL 4.4+.
The new version support looks like:
- Kernel 4.1 and older => OpenGL 3.3
- Kernel 4.2-4.3 => OpenGL 4.2
- Kernel 4.4-4.7 => OpenGL 4.3
- Kernel 4.8+ => OpenGL 4.5

The header of ralloc needs to be aligned, because the compiler assumes
that malloc returns will be aligned to 8/16 bytes depending on the
platform, leading to degraded performance or alignment faults with ralloc.
Fixes SIGBUS on Raspberry Pi at high optimization levels.
This patch is not perfect for MSVC, as maybe in the future the alignment
for the most demanding data type might change to more than 8.
v2: Commit message reword/typo fix, and add a bigger explanation in the
code (by anholt)
Signed-off-by: Jonas Pfeil <pfeiljonas@gmx.de>
Reviewed-by: Matt Turner <mattst88@gmail.com>
Reviewed-by: Marek Olšák <marek.olsak@amd.com>
Cc: mesa-stable@lists.freedesktop.org
(cherry picked from commit cd2b55e536)
Squashed with
ralloc: don't leave out the alignment factor
Experimentation shows that without alignment factor gcc and clang choose
a factor of 16 even on IA-32, which doesn't match what malloc() uses (8).
The problem is it makes gcc assume the pointer is 16 byte aligned, so
with -O3 it starts using aligned SSE instructions that later fault,
so always specify a suitable alignment factor.

Previously we disabled the guardband when the viewport was smaller than
the framebuffer on Gen6-7.5, to prevent portions of primitives from
being draw outside of the viewport. On Gen8+, we relied on the viewport
extents test to effectively scissor this away for us.
We can simply always enable scissoring instead. We already include the
viewport in the scissor rectangle, so this will effectively do the
viewport extents test for us. (The only difference is that the scissor
rectangle doesn't support sub-pixel values. I think that's okay.)
Given that the viewport extents test is essentially a second scissor,
and is enabled for basically all 3D drawing on Gen8+, it stands to
reason that scissoring is cheap. Enabling the guardband reduces the
cost of clipping, which is expensive.
The Windows driver appears to never disable guardband clipping, and
appears to use scissoring in this case. I don't know if they leave
it on universally though.
This fixes misrendering in Blender, where the "floor plane" grid lines
started rendering at wrong angles after I disabled XY clipping of line
primitives. Enabling the guardband seems to solve the issue.

We scaled the guardband based on the viewport size, but failed to
take into account the translation portion of the viewport transform.
This meant the guardband was always centered around the origin.
We want it to be centered around the screen-space drawing area,
which is the intersection of the viewport and the render target.
At best, getting this wrong would reduce the guardband's effectiveness
in some cases. At worst, it might break things - objects outside of the
guardband are trivially rejected, so getting the guardband in the wrong
place and leaving guardband clipping enabled could cause problems.

It is not clear from the docs exactly how pipelined STATE_BASE_ADDRESS
actually is. We know from experimentation that we need to flush the
render cache prior to emitting STATE_BASE_ADDRESS and invalidate the
texture cache afterwards. The only thing the PRM says is that, on gen8+
we're supposed to invalidate the state cache after STATE_BASE_ADDRESS
but experimentation has indicated that doing so does nothing whatsoever.
Since we don't really know, let's do just a bit more flushing in the
hopes that this won't be a problem again. In particular:
1) Do a CS stall before we emit STATE_BASE_ADDRESS since we don't
really know whether or not it's pipelined.
2) Do a data cache flush in case what runs before STATE_BASE_ADDRESS
is a compute shader.
3) Invalidate the state and constant caches after STATE_BASE_ADDRESS
because the state may be getting cached there (we don't really know).

Applications may delete a shader program, create a new one, and bind it
before the next draw. With terrible luck, malloc may randomly return a
chunk of memory for the new gl_program that happened to be the exact
same pointer as our previously bound gl_program. In this case, our
logic to detect new programs in brw_upload_pipeline_state() would break:
if (brw->vertex_program != ctx->VertexProgram._Current) {
brw->vertex_program = ctx->VertexProgram._Current;
brw->ctx.NewDriverState |= BRW_NEW_VERTEX_PROGRAM;
}
Because the pointer is the same, we'd think it was the same program.
But it could be wildly different - a different stage altogether,
different sets of resources, and so on. This causes utter chaos.
As unlikely as this seems, I believe I hit this when running a subset
of the CTS in a loop, in a group of tests that churns through simple
programs, deleting and rebuilding them. Presumably malloc uses a
bucketing cache of sorts, and so freeing up a gl_program and allocating
a new one fairly quickly causes it to reuse that memory.
The result was that brw->vertex_program->info.num_ssbos claimed the
program had SSBOs, while brw->vs.base.prog_data.binding_table claimed
that there were none. This was crazy, because the binding table is
calculated from info.num_ssbos - the shader info appeared to change
between shader compile time and draw time. Careful use of watchpoints
revealed that it was being clobbered by rzalloc's memset when building
an entirely different program...
Fortunately, our 0xd0d0d0d0 canary for unused binding table entries
caused us to crash out of bounds when trying to upload SSBOs, or we
may have never discovered this heisenbug.

OpenGL ES implementations are not allowed to ship ARB extensions, and
OpenGL implementations are not allowed to ship OES extensions.
The functionality is also included in GL_ARB_ES2_compatibility. Ever
OpenGL core-profile driver currently exposes both extensions. I don't
know of any applications that explicitly check for GL_OES_read_format,
so removing it seems very unlikely to cause problems. No functionality
is removed.
I have left this extension in place for compatibility profile. There
are still OpenGL 1.x drivers in Mesa, and adding code to check for
compatibility profile and not GL_ARB_ES2_compatibility for
GL_IMPLEMENTATION_COLOR_READ_TYPE and GL_IMPLEMENTATION_COLOR_READ_FORMAT
just feels dumb.
Three other other alternatives considered:
- Remove the string from compatibility profile drivers but leave the
functionality in place.
- Add a flag to expose the extension string, and set it in every OpenGL
driver that does not expose GL_ARB_ES2_compatibility (and those
drivers only). I tried this. You can't have two instances of an
extension in the extension table (one dummy_true for ES1 and one with
a flag for compatibility profile), so the implementation requires a
bit of effort.
- Only expose the extension in compatibility if the version is less
than 2.0. I didn't see an easy way to do this.

The previous code always compared integers as 64-bit. Due to variations
in sign-extension in the code generated by nir_opt_algebraic.py, this
meant that nir_search doesn't always do what you want. Instead, 32-bit
values should be matched as 32-bit and 64-bit values should be matched
as 64-bit. While we're here we unify the unsigned and signed paths.
Now that we're using the right bit size, they should be the same since
the only difference we had before was sign extension.
This gets the UE4 bitfield_extract optimization working again. It had
stopped working due to the constant 0xff00ff00 getting sign-extended
when it shouldn't have.
